Namespace Aspose.Html.Dom.Css

Namespace Aspose.Html.Dom.Css

Classes

Luokan nimiDescription
CSSPrimitiveValueCSSPrimitiveValue -liittymä edustaa yksittäistä CSS-arvoa. Tämä käyttöliittymä voidaan käyttää määrittää tietyn tyylin omaisuuden arvo tällä hetkellä blokiin tai määrittää tietyn tyylin omaisuuden nimenomaisesti blokiin. Esimerkki tästä käyttöliittymästä voidaan saada CSSStyylin ilmoitusliittymän getPropertyCSSValue -menetelmästä. CSSPrimitiveValue -objekti tapahtuu vain CSS-ominaisuuden yhteydessä.
CSSValueSe edustaa yksinkertaista tai monimutkaista arvoa. CSSValue-objekti tapahtuu vain CSS-ominaisuuden yhteydessä.
CSSValueListCSSValueList -liittymä tarjoaa CSS-arvojen järjestetyn kokoelman vähennyksen.
CounterCounter-liittymää käytetään edustamaan mitä tahansa counter- tai counter-toimintoarvoa.Tämä käyttöliittymä heijastaa arvoja perustavanlaatuisessa tyylin ominaisuudessa.
RGBColorRGBColor-liitäntä käytetään minkä tahansa RGB-värin arvon esittämiseen. Tämä käyttöliittymä heijastaa taustalla olevan tyylin ominaisuuden arvoja. Näin ollen CSSPrimitiveValue-objektien tekemät muutokset muuttavat tyylin ominaisuutta.
RectRect-liitäntöä käytetään jokaisen rect-arvon esittämiseen. Tämä käyttöliittymä heijastaa taustalla olevan tyylin ominaisuuden arvoja. Näin ollen CSSPrimitiveValue-objektien tekemät muutokset muuttavat tyylin ominaisuutta.

Interfaces

käyttöliittymän nimiDescription
ICSS2PropertiesTarjoaa käyttöliittymän CSS2 ominaisuuksiin asettaa arvojen manipulointi yhteydessä tietty HTML elementti
ICSSCharsetRuleCSSCharsetRule-liittymä edustaa @charset-sääntöä CSS-tyylilehdessä. koodausominaisuuden arvo ei vaikuta tekstitietojen koodaukseen DOM-objekteissa; tämä koodaus on aina UTF-16. Kun tyylilehti on ladattava, koodausominaisuuden arvo on @charset-sääntöä. Jos alkuperäisessä asiakirjassa ei ollut @charset-sääntöä, niin ei luoda CSSCharsetRule-sääntöä. koodausominaisuuden arvoa voidaan käyttää myös ohjeena koodaukseen, jota käytetään tyylilehden serialisoinnissa.
ICSSCounterStyleRule@counter-tyylin sääntö mahdollistaa kirjoittajien määrittelemän räätälöidyn counter-tyylin.
ICSSFontFaceRuleCSSFontFaceRule-liittymä edustaa @font-face-sääntöä CSS-tyylilehdessä. @font-face-sääntöä käytetään fontin kuvausten kokoonpanoon.
ICSSImportRuleCSSImportRule-liittymä edustaa @import-sääntöä CSS-tyylilehdessä. @import-sääntöä käytetään muilta tyylilehdiltä tuodakseen tyylisääntöjä.
ICSSKeyframeRuleCSSKeyframeRule-liittymä edustaa tyylin sääntöä yhdelle avaimelle.
ICSSKeyframesRuleCSSKeyframesRule-liittymä edustaa täydellistä joukkoa avainpuitteita yhdelle animaatiolle
ICSSMarginRuleCSSMarginRule -liittymä edustaa marginaalia säännössä.
ICSSMediaRuleCSSMediaRule-liittymä edustaa @media-sääntöä CSS-tyylilehdessä. @media-sääntöä voidaan käyttää tiettyjen media-tyyppien tyylisääntöjen määrittämiseen.
ICSSPageRuleCSSPageRule-liittymä edustaa @page-sääntöä CSS-tyylilevyn sisällä. @page-sääntöä käytetään määrittämään sivupöydän ulottuvuudet, suuntautuminen, marginaalit jne.
ICSSRuleCSSRule-liittymä on abstrakti pohja-liittymä minkä tahansa CSS-ilmoituksen tyypille. Tämä sisältää sekä sääntöasetuksia että sääntöjä. toteutuksen odotetaan säilyttävän kaikki CSS-tyylilehdessä määritellyt säännöt, vaikka sääntö ei tunnusteta ostaja. Tunnistamattomat säännöt esitetään ICSSUnknownRule -liittymällä.
ICSSRuleListCSSRuleList -liittymä tarjoaa CSS-sääntöjen järjestetyn kokoonpanon abstraktion.
ICSSStyleDeclarationCSSStyleDeclaration -liittymä edustaa yksittäistä CSS-julistuksen lohkoa. tätä käyttöliittymää voidaan käyttää määrittämään tyylin ominaisuudet, jotka on tällä hetkellä asetettu lohkoon, tai asettaa tyylin ominaisuuksia nimenomaisesti lohkoon.
ICSSStyleRuleCSSStyleRule -liittymä edustaa yhden säännön, joka on asetettu CSS-tyylilehdessä.
ICSSStyleSheetCSSStyleSheet -liittymä on konkreettinen käyttöliittymä, jota käytetään esittämään CSS-tyylilehti eli tyylilehti, jonka sisällön tyyppi on “tekst/css”.
ICSSUnknownRuleCSSUnknownRule -liittymä edustaa pääsääntöisesti tätä käyttäjäagenttia ei tueta.
ICSSValueListSisältö tarjoaa CSS-arvojen järjestetyn kokoelman vähennyksen.
IDocumentCSSTämä käyttöliittymä edustaa asiakirjaa, jolla on CSS-näkökulma.
IDocumentStyleDocumentStyle -liittymä tarjoaa mekanismin, jonka avulla asiakirjaan sisällytetyt tyylilehdet voidaan saada takaisin. odotetaan, että DocumentStyle -liittymän esimerkki voidaan saada käyttämällä sitovaa työntämismenetelmää asiakirja-liittymän esimerkissä.
IElementCSSInlineStyleInline tyyli tietoja liitetään elementtejä on altistettu kautta tyyli ominaisuus. Tämä edustaa sisältöä tyyli ominaisuus HTML elementtejä (tai elementtejä muissa järjestelmissä tai DTDs, jotka käyttävät tyyli ominaisuus samalla tavalla).
ILinkStyleLinkStyle-liitäntä tarjoaa mekanismin, jonka avulla tyylilevyä voidaan perustaa asiakirjaan linkittämisestä vastaavasta nodeesta. LinkStyle-liitäntä voi saada käyttämällä sitova-erityisiä kastamismenetelmiä linkitysnoden (HTMLLinkElement, HTMLStyleElement tai ProcessingInstruktion DOM-tasolla 2).
IMediaListMediaList -liittymä antaa tilauksen median kokoonpanon vähennyksen määrittämättä tai rajoittamatta sitä, miten tämä kokoelma toteutetaan. tyhjä luettelo on sama kuin luettelo, joka sisältää median “kaikki”.
IStyleSheetStyleSheet-liittymä on abstrakti pohja-liittymä minkä tahansa tyypillisen tyylilevyn osalta. se edustaa yhden tyylilevyn, joka liittyy rakenteelliseen asiakirjaan.
IStyleSheetListStyleSheetList -liittymä antaa abstraktion tilatusta tyylilehdistä.
IViewCSSTämä käyttöliittymä edustaa CSS-näkökulmaa.

Enums

Enum nimiDescription
CSSEngineModeMääritä CSSEngine Mode
 Suomi